Technological Advancements Shaping the Future

The next few years promise to bring entirely new gaming experiences rooted in cutting-edge technologies such as artificial intelligence (AI), virtual reality (VR), and blockchain integration. These innovations are not merely incremental; they are set to redefine the core of online slots.

  • Personalization through AI: AI algorithms are increasingly used to analyze player data, allowing platforms to tailor game suggestions, bonus offers, and interfaces to individual preferences. This enhances engagement and retention.
  • Immersive VR Experiences: Virtual reality promises to bring players into simulated environments resembling land-based casinos, with 3D slot machines and social interactions, enhancing realism and excitement.
  • Blockchain and Cryptocurrency: Decentralized ledgers facilitate transparent and secure transactions, with some operators experimenting with crypto-based slots to attract a broader demographic.

These technological shifts are steadily becoming industry standards, as operators seek to differentiate their offerings in a fiercely competitive market.

Regulatory and Ethical Considerations

Legislative landscapes are also evolving, with regulators emphasizing player protection, fair gaming, and responsible gambling. By 2026, we expect tighter regulations surrounding data privacy, anti-money laundering measures, and licensing frameworks.

“Stakeholders are increasingly prioritizing transparency and player well-being, which influences game design, marketing, and operational practices,” notes industry analyst James Clarkson.

The incorporation of responsible gambling tools, such as personalized self-assessment and deposit limits, will become integral to online slots platforms, fostering sustainable growth in the industry.

Market Dynamics and Consumer Preferences

Millennial and Generation Z players are shaping demand with their preferences for social, mobile, and multi-sensory experiences. The integration of social gaming features—leaderboards, multiplayer modes, and live dealer elements—is likely to surge, fostering communities rather than just solitary gameplay.
